引言
在数字化时代,网络安全已成为企业和个人关注的焦点。信息泄露事件频发,给企业和个人带来了巨大的损失。为了有效预防和应对信息泄露,日志分析技术应运而生。本文将深入探讨日志导弹的概念、工作原理以及如何利用日志分析技术追踪信息泄露,从而守护网络安全。
一、什么是日志导弹?
1.1 定义
日志导弹是一种基于日志分析技术的网络安全工具,通过对网络设备、系统、应用程序等产生的日志数据进行实时监控、分析和处理,以发现潜在的安全威胁和异常行为。
1.2 功能
- 实时监控:对网络设备、系统、应用程序等产生的日志数据进行实时监控,及时发现异常行为。
- 异常检测:通过分析日志数据,识别出潜在的安全威胁和异常行为。
- 安全预警:对发现的安全威胁和异常行为进行预警,提醒用户采取措施。
- 数据分析:对日志数据进行深度分析,挖掘潜在的安全风险。
二、日志导弹的工作原理
2.1 日志收集
日志导弹首先需要收集网络设备、系统、应用程序等产生的日志数据。这些日志数据通常包括访问日志、错误日志、安全日志等。
2.2 数据预处理
收集到的日志数据需要进行预处理,包括数据清洗、格式化、去重等操作,以确保后续分析的质量。
2.3 特征提取
从预处理后的日志数据中提取关键特征,如IP地址、用户名、访问时间、访问路径等。
2.4 异常检测
利用机器学习、统计分析等方法,对提取的特征进行分析,识别出潜在的安全威胁和异常行为。
2.5 安全预警
对检测到的安全威胁和异常行为进行预警,提醒用户采取措施。
三、如何利用日志导弹追踪信息泄露?
3.1 常见信息泄露类型
- 数据库泄露:数据库中的敏感信息被非法访问或窃取。
- 文件泄露:企业内部文件被非法下载或泄露。
- 代码泄露:企业内部代码被非法获取或泄露。
3.2 追踪信息泄露的方法
- 分析访问日志:通过分析访问日志,发现异常访问行为,如频繁访问敏感文件、异常访问时间等。
- 分析安全日志:通过分析安全日志,发现安全事件,如登录失败、密码破解等。
- 分析数据库日志:通过分析数据库日志,发现数据库访问异常,如非法访问、数据篡改等。
3.3 实例分析
以下是一个利用日志导弹追踪信息泄露的实例:
- 收集并预处理日志数据。
- 提取关键特征,如IP地址、用户名、访问时间、访问路径等。
- 利用机器学习算法分析特征,识别出异常访问行为。
- 对异常访问行为进行预警,提醒用户采取措施。
四、总结
日志导弹作为一种有效的网络安全工具,可以帮助企业和个人及时发现和应对信息泄露。通过深入了解日志导弹的工作原理和追踪信息泄露的方法,我们可以更好地守护网络安全,降低信息泄露风险。
